If you're dying for a good, queer, Hallmark holiday movie, stop waiting and read this book instead! Morgan Ross and Rachel Reed are former best friends who are thrown together by the need to save Rachel's small town Christmas tree farm from being bought out by a soulless property developer. Morgan, who has been working as a big city events planner, returns to the town of Fern Falls after a disastrous scandal, in order to plan a fundraiser for the farm and, of course, to show her boss that she still deserves the promotion she has been waiting for. When sparks reignite between the two, will Morgan choose to stay in Fern Falls or go back to her big city life?
The characters in this book were all very entertaining - I'm happy to see this listed as Fern Falls #1, because I already can't wait to delve into the lives of some of the supporting characters from this book! The quirky small town setting is just what I like in a romance. Overall, a sweet and fun holiday romance.
